Farm Clearing in Houston, TX
Farm clearing services involve the removal of unwanted vegetation, trees, brush, and debris from agricultural or rural properties. This type of service is commonly requested for projects such as preparing land for new farming operations, creating open space for development, or managing overgrown areas.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of clearing, including whether trees, stumps, or underbrush will be removed, as well as any potential impact on the land’s accessibility and future use.
Before requesting farm clearing, property owners should consider the size of the area to be cleared, the types of vegetation present, and any local regulations or permits that may be required. It’s also helpful to identify specific goals for the land post-clearing, such as leveling for construction or maintaining open pasture, to ensure the service aligns with those needs. Clear communication about these factors can help facilitate a smooth and effective clearing process.

Farm Clearing Questions
What types of projects do farm clearing services handle? They typically manage land preparation, removal of brush, trees, and debris to make land suitable for farming, development, or recreation.
Is farm clearing suitable for large or small properties? Yes, services can be tailored to both large rural parcels and smaller acreage, depending on the property's needs.
What equipment is used in farm cl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and skid steers are commonly used to efficiently clear land.
What should property owners consider before farm clearing? It’s important to evaluate the land’s topography, existing vegetation, and any local regulations or permits required.
